Frequently Asked Questions
What specific local zoning or land use issues in Mount Freedom, NJ, should I discuss with a real estate attorney?
Given Mount Freedom's location within Randolph Township, a local attorney can advise on township-specific zoning ordinances, well and septic system regulations for properties not on municipal sewer, and any historic preservation guidelines that may affect renovations. They are crucial for navigating variances or approvals from the Randolph Township Land Use Board.
How can a Mount Freedom real estate attorney help with a contract for the sale of a seasonal or vacation-type home common in the area?
An attorney familiar with the local market can draft or review contracts to address issues specific to seasonal properties, such as clear terms for furniture/conveyances, well and septic inspections, and provisions for closing timing that aligns with the seasonal rental market. They ensure your interests are protected in transactions often involving out-of-area buyers.
Are there unique title search considerations for older properties in Mount Freedom that a real estate attorney handles?
Yes. Older properties may have complex title histories, including unrecorded easements, old right-of-way agreements, or potential boundary discrepancies. A local attorney will ensure a thorough title search is conducted, addressing any issues specific to Morris County records and facilitating title insurance to protect your investment.
What role does a real estate attorney play in a 1031 exchange for an investment property in Mount Freedom, NJ?
A New Jersey-licensed attorney is essential for structuring a compliant 1031 exchange, which allows deferring capital gains taxes. They work with your qualified intermediary to ensure all strict IRS deadlines are met, the replacement property is correctly identified, and the transaction adheres to New Jersey's real estate laws and closing procedures.
When buying a home in a Mount Freedom community with a homeowners association (HOA), what should my attorney review?
Your attorney should meticulously review the HOA's master deed, bylaws, rules, and recent financial statements. They will identify any special assessments, restrictions (e.g., on rentals, sheds, or parking), and the HOA's reserve funds to ensure you understand all obligations and avoid unexpected costs after purchasing in communities common to the area.
